CHARLES AMES, 73
Funeral services will be held Friday at 2:00 at the Beebe Funeral Home for Charles Paul Ames, 73, of Hudson, who died Wednesday morning at the Hillsdale Community health Center where he had been a patient for five days.
Burial will be in Sunset View Cemetery.
Mr. Ames was born December 1, 1894, in Hudson, the son of Frank and Dollie Masters Ames.
A resident of the Hudson area all his life, he attended Hudson High School, farmed and was an employee of Consumers Power Co. in Jonesville until his retirement in 1960.
he was also married in Hudson to Sarah Louise Norris who died April 28, 1957. A brother, Robert, also preceded him in death.
He is survived by one daughter, mrs. kenneth (Evelyn) Reed, 227 Steamburg Rd., Hillsdale, with whom he resided the past several months; two sons, Lyle of Hudson and Charles of Quincy; two sisters, Miss Helen Ames and mrs. Rex (Emiley) Likely of Hudson; five brothers, Henry, Clifford, Byron, Frank and Earl, all of Hudson; 14 grandchildren and 25 great-grandchildren.
The family will receive friends at the Beebe Funeral Home tonight (Thursday) from 7:00 to 9:00.
